What's a good ATV size for an experienced rider that's over 6'0 and around 200lbs. I been looking at the "Komoto" and "SUnL" 250cc Chinese brand, mainly for the $$. I'm not planning on jumping doubles and racing, but I do plan on throwing it around in the woods and hoping it will throw me around because of the power. What I'm concerned with is finding parts like brake pads, tires, clutch levers and cables, just things that tend to break. Also dimesnions of the bike and fuel capacity is a biggie for selling me. Sounds like you'll be somewhat rough on your quad. It is my recommendation that you get a Honeda EX400 or close to that size...you are about my size. However, if you don't want the expense, my friend has been riding a Redcat DPX 200, it has a manual hand clutch, but execpt for the battery, it has held up. If you buy a Chinese quad, I must insist that you get it from Raceway. It can be hit or miss on quality...and if you miss, the extra money you spend will be worth it. They walk the walk and have future parts support. Hope this helps. SEADAWG

for whar you spend on a 250 china quad, for 500 bucks more you can find a used jap quad, it would be much better for a adult, the china quads can be alright but they are better suited for kids.

Look at kymco, Little cheaper than japanese but same quality or maybe better than some models. I buyed a yamoto 200 in march and a mammoth 90 for my son ,but nothing than problems . Our friends buyed them for their kids and we buyed all kymco`s. I have a mongoose 300, wife mongoose 250 and son mongoose 90.
Kymco makes the quads for arctic cat , kawa, i think even honda use them.
